Guest User

Untitled

a guest
Jul 22nd, 2018
80
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.75 KB | None | 0 0
  1. using System;
  2. using System.Collections.Generic;
  3. using System.Text;
  4.  
  5. namespace zadanie_min_max
  6. {
  7. class Program
  8. {
  9. static void MinMax(int [] tablica, out int Min, out int lMin, out int Max, out int lMax)
  10. {
  11. Max = 0;
  12. Min = tablica[1];
  13. lMin = lMax = 0;
  14.  
  15. int dlTab = tablica.Length;
  16. for (int i = 0; i < dlTab; i++)
  17. {
  18. if (Min >= tablica[i])
  19. {
  20. Min = tablica[i];
  21. lMin++;
  22. }
  23. if (Max <= tablica[i])
  24. {
  25. Max = tablica[i];
  26. }
  27.  
  28. }
  29. for (int i = 0; i < dlTab; i++)
  30. {
  31. if (Max == tablica[i]) lMax++;
  32. }
  33.  
  34. }
  35. static void Main(string[] args)
  36. {
  37. int lOcen, ocena;
  38. int Min, Max, lMin, lMax;
  39. Console.WriteLine("podaj liczbę ocen");
  40. while (!int.TryParse(Console.ReadLine(), out lOcen) | lOcen < 1)
  41. Console.WriteLine("błąd!");
  42. int[] oceny = new int [lOcen];
  43. for (int i = 0; i < lOcen; i++)
  44. {
  45. Console.WriteLine("podaj {0} ocenę" , i+1);
  46. while (!int.TryParse(Console.ReadLine(), out ocena) | ocena < 1 | ocena > 6)
  47. Console.WriteLine("błąd!");
  48. oceny[i] = ocena;
  49. }
  50. MinMax(oceny, out Min, out lMin, out Max, out lMax);
  51. Console.WriteLine("ocena największa {0}, liczba największych {1}, ocena najmniejsza {2}, liczba najmniejszych {3}", Max, lMax, Min, lMin);
  52. Console.ReadKey();
  53.  
  54.  
  55. }
  56. }
  57. }
Add Comment
Please, Sign In to add comment